A new wave of technology companies is transforming how commercial buildings manage their heating, ventilation, and air conditioning systems. These startups are applying artificial intelligence and machine learning algorithms to tackle the complexities of HVAC optimization, moving beyond traditional control methods to achieve significant energy savings. According to Memoori’s research report, “Energy Management Software for HVAC Optimization in Commercial Buildings,” these companies are gaining traction by demonstrating consistent, measurable improvements in building performance. The intersection of artificial intelligence and building systems has created opportunities for innovative approaches to energy management. While established building automation companies maintain a significant market presence, these newer entrants are leveraging advanced algorithms, predictive analytics, and autonomous control systems to deliver enhanced results.
